Description

Stylish 5 tier wall mountable beech effect finish display unit with pale grey painted backboard and four adjustable shelves and double sliding tempered glass doors. Ideal for showing off your collectables from ornaments to model cars and trains. Shelves are 6.5cm deep and when evenly spaced are 10cm apart.

Humble Beginnings

In 1980, Chris Dawson set up a simple open-air market stall in Plymouth. By 1989, this entrepreneurial spirit led to the opening of the very first physical store on Billacombe Road, originally named "C.D.S. Superstores". However, in the early '90s, a rebranding took place, introducing "The Range" to the world.

Today, with a whopping 200+ stores across the UK, The Range boasts an impressive selection of over 65,000 products, spreading across 16 diverse departments, all dedicated to enhancing homes and lifestyles.

A Visionary Leader

Chris Dawson, the brain behind The Range, held the CEO position from 1989 to 2017. With a flair for business, Chris's achievements haven't gone unnoticed. He was even ranked fifth in a survey of Britain's Top 100 Entrepreneurs.

Under his leadership, The Range has not only thrived locally but has also hinted at European expansion dreams, envisioning a staggering 1,000 stores across the continent.
